I agree that for the most general case, you want NR_CPUS to be 2048, which requires CPUMASK_OFFSTACK. But it would be legitimate to build a kernel with NR_CPUS set to something like 64 or 256 for a more limited Hyper-V guest use case, and to not want to incur the cost of CPUMASK_OFFSTACK. You could consider doing something like this: select CPUMASK_OFFSTACK if NR_CPUS > 512 But kernel builders always have the option of explicitly enabling CPUMASK_OFFSTACK. That's what I see in the distro vendor arm64 images in Azure, since there's currently nothing that automatically selects CPUMASK_OFFSTACK for arm64. So I'm wondering if selecting CPUMASK_OFFSTACK under HYPERV should be added at all. The two aren't really related. There are recent LKML threads on enabling CPUMASK_OFFSTACK for arm64 -- see links below for some useful discussion of the topic in general.
